Transaction 0664ab159a3ea43c4d38b345635ae08d6015937bcc9dad98fe0ef0ed9cc9a1ae
1 Input
1 Output
-
0664ab159a3ea43c4d38b345635ae08d6015937bcc9dad98fe0ef0ed9cc9a1ae:0
- value
- 717376
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f825d72e3f6bfb3f4c438ac515211b570711268f OP_EQUAL
- address
- 3QK6qKp7PMzbndDTgLK8W9CSHqDw4g5UHJ